Rock women finish fourth at Shamrock Invitational

Slippery Rock was the top non-Division I team at the Shamrock Invitational this weekend with a fourth place finish in the team standings.

Results

MYRTLE BEACH, S.C. – The Slippery Rock University women's track and field team closed its spring break trip with a fourth place finish at the Alan Connie Shamrock Invitational that wrapped up Saturday from Doug Shaw Memorial Stadium in Myrtle Beach.
 
The Rock were the highest finishing non-Division I team in the final team standings in fourth place overall with 82.5 points. Duke won the team title with 247 points, followed by James Madison with 111.5 points and Coastal Carolina with 87 points. Mount Saint Mary's ronded out the top five with 41 points to make The Rock the only non-Division I team in the top five. A total of 32 different teams tallied points at the three-day competition that began Thursday.
 
Slippery Rock finished the meet with 17 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ference qualifying marks and 17 top 10 finishes in seeded events.
 
Slippery Rock had five distance runners record top five finishes at the meet, led by Katie Plassio with a runner-up finish in the 10,000-meter run in 38:43. Marianne Abdalah took fifth in the same race in 39:03.71. Anna Igims was third in the 5,000-meter run in 17:44.19 and Maddie Grillo and Marie Scarpa both hit PSAC marks in the 3,000-meter steeplechase. Grillo was third in 11:57.97 and Scarpa finished fourth in 12:05.51.
 
Slippery Rock got a pair of PSAC marks in the 100-meter dash with Haley Morgan finishing 18th in 12.59 seconds and Regan Johnson placing 20th in 12.60 seconds. They also teamed with Amaya Robinson and Baylee Blauser to place sixth in the 4x100-meter relay in 49.10 seconds.
 
SRU got one PSAC mark in the 200-meter dash from Lorna Speigle during the heptathlon when she clocked a time of 26.19 seconds and also got one PSAC mark in the 400-meter dash with Alice Bogia finishing 17th in 59.87 seconds. Speigle ended up third overall in the heptathlon with 4,059 points. Dani MacBeth was fifth with 3,672 points, followed by Madelyn Miller in eighth with 3,283 points and Alison Lamoreaux in 10th with 2,753 points.
 
The final PSAC marks on the track came in the hurdle races, where Rachel Veneziano was 11th in the 400-meter hurdles in 1:07.26 and Chaley Younkin was 15th in 15.09 seconds.
 
The Rock had four top 10 finishes in the throwing events, led by Sarah Corrie with a second place effort in the shot put with a toss of 13.41 meters. Olivia Heckman took fifth in the shot with a toss of 12.46 meters. Tiffany Jolayemi was 10th in the hammer throw with a mark of 46.64 meters and also took ninth in the discus with a throw of 36.84 meters.
 
Allie Taylor and Kendall Grossman tied for fourth in the pole vault with PSAC qualifying clearances of 3.35 meters and Aleks Brozeski rounded out the final PSAC marks of the weekend with a 13th place finish in the long jump with a leap of 5.34 meters.
 
Slippery Rock will take next weekend off before hosting the first of four home meets this spring with the Dave Labor Invitational set for April 1.
